Abstract
Microalgae are generally considered an excellent source of vitamins, minerals, and bioactive molecules that make them suitable to be introduced in cosmetics, pharmaceuticals, and food industries. Aphanizomenon flos-aquae (AFA), an edible microalga, contains numerous biomolecules potentially able to prevent some pathologies including age-related disorders. With the aim to include an AFA extract (Klamin®) as a functional ingredient in baked products, we investigated if its bioactive molecules are destroyed or inactivated after standard cooking temperature. The AFA extract was exposed to heat stress (AFA-HS), and no significant decrease in pigment, polyphenol, and carotenoid content was detected by spectroscopic analysis. Thermal stability of AFA-HS extract was demonstrated by thermogravimetric analysis (TGA), and no change in the morphology of the granules of the powder was noticed by SEM microscopic observation. By Folin-Ciocalteu, ORAC, and ABTS assays, no change in the antioxidant activity and polyphenol contents was found after high-temperature exposition. When added in cell culture, solubilized AFA-HS lost neither its scavenging ability against ROS generation nor its protective role against Abeta, the main peptide involved in Alzheimer's disease. Prebiotic and antioxidant activities of AFA extract that are not lost after thermal stress were verified on E. coli bacteria. Finally, AFA-HS cookies, containing the extract as one of their ingredients, showed increased polyphenols. Here, we evaluate the possibility to use the AFA extract to produce functional food and prevent metabolic and age-related diseases.

Abstract
Eighty-eight patients with head and neck cancer were prospectively monitored, before and after treatment, by means of simultaneous serum SCC, CEA and TATI measurements. Thirty-two (36.6%) patients had early stages (I, II, III) and 56 (63.4%) advanced (stage IV) or recurrent disease. Pre-treatment serum SCC levels were elevated in 20.4% of patients, CEA in 27.2% and TATI in 4.5%. There was no correlation between the incidence of TATI elevation and tumour burden; this marker did not increase with progressing disease stages. CEA and SCC had low sensitivity in the early stages of head and neck cancer and reached 35.7% (20/56 patients) and 25% (14/56 patients) in stage IV or recurrent disease. Despite the low sensitivity of these tumour markers, there was a correlation between tumour marker levels and the course of the disease. This study indicates that the routine assessment of SCC, CEA and TATI serum levels is of no value. However, it can be used as a potential tool for monitoring the efficacy of individual therapy in both early and advanced stages of head and neck cancer.

Abstract
Properly engineered scaffolds combined with functional neurons can be instrumental for the effective repair of the neural tissue. In particular, it is essential to investigate how three-dimensional (3D) systems and topographical features can impact on neuronal activity to obtain engineered functional neural tissues. In this study, polyphenylene sulfone (PPSu) scaffolds constituted by randomly distributed or aligned electrospun nanofibers were fabricated to evaluate the neural activity in 3D culture environments for the first time. The obtained results demonstrated that the nanofibers can successfully support the adhesion and growth of neural stem cells (NSCs) and enhance neuronal differentiation compared to 2D substrates. In addition, NSCs could spread and migrate along the aligned fibers. The percentage of active NSC-derived neurons and the overall network activity in the fibrous substrates were also remarkably enhanced. Finally, the data of neuronal activity showed not only that the neurons cultured on the nanofibers are part of a functional network, but also that their activity increases, and the direction of neural signals can be controlled in the aligned 3D scaffolds.

Abstract
We show the development of a new class of highly efficient, biocompatible fiducial markers for X-ray imaging and radiosurgery, based on polymer shells encapsulating engineered gold nanoparticle (AuNP) suspensions. Our smart fabrication strategy enables wide tunability of the fiducial size, shape, and X-ray attenuation performance, up to record values >20 000 Hounsfield units (HU), i.e. comparable to or even higher than bulk gold. We show that the NP fiducials allow for superior imaging both in vitro and in vivo (yet requiring 2 orders of magnitude less material), with strong stability over time and the absence of classical "streak artifacts" of standard bulk fiducials. NP fiducials were probed in vivo, showing exceptional contrast efficiency, even after 2 weeks post-implant in mice.

Abstract
In the biomedical sector the availability of engineered scaffolds and dressings that control and reduce inflammatory states is highly desired, particularly for the management of burn wounds. In this work, we demonstrate for the first time, to the best of our knowledge, that electrospun fibrous dressings of poly(octyl cyanoacrylate) (POCA) combined with polypropylene fumarate (PPF) possess anti-inflammatory activity and promote the fast and effective healing of mild skin burns in an animal model. The fibers produced had an average diameter of (0.8 ± 0.1) µm and they were able to provide a conformal coverage of the injured tissue. The application of the fibrous mats on the burned tissue effectively reduced around 80% of the levels of pro-inflammatory cytokines in the first 48 h in comparison with un-treated animals, and enhanced skin epithelialization. From histological analysis, the skin thickness of the animals treated with POCA : PPF dressings appeared similar to that of one of the naïve animals: (13.7 ± 1.4) µm and (14.3 ± 2.5) µm for naïve and treated animals, respectively. The density of dermal cells was comparable as well: (1100 ± 112) cells mm(-2) and (1358 ± 255) cells mm(-2) for naïve and treated mice, respectively. The results demonstrate the suitability of the electrospun dressings in accelerating and effectively promoting the burn healing process.

Abstract
We demonstrate high-resolution photocross-linking of biodegradable poly(propylene fumarate) (PPF) and diethyl fumarate (DEF) using UV excimer laser photocuring at 308 nm. The curing depth can be tuned in a micrometre range by adjusting the total energy dose (total fluence). Young's moduli of the scaffolds are found to be a few gigapascal, high enough to support bone formation. The results presented here demonstrate that the proposed technique is an excellent tool for the fabrication of stiff and biocompatible structures on a micrometre scale with defined patterns of high resolution in all three spatial dimensions. Using UV laser photocuring at 308 nm will significantly improve the speed of rapid prototyping of biocompatible and biodegradable polymer scaffolds and enables its production in a few seconds, providing high lateral and horizontal resolution. This short timescale is indeed a tremendous asset that will enable a more efficient translation of technology to clinical applications. Preliminary cell tests proved that PPF : DEF scaffolds produced by excimer laser photocuring are biocompatible and, therefore, are promising candidates to be applied in tissue engineering and regenerative medicine.

Abstract
In this work a new approach is introduced for surface properties control by laser texturing process. By UV laser irradiation, we are able to control the surface wettability of a chitosan polymeric film in which is introduced a chloroauric acid salt by immersion. Specifically the UV irradiation is responsible for the creation of gold nanoparticles at the irradiated surface of the polymeric film. This photolytic process allows us to localize and design accurately surface patterns and moreover to tune metallic particle size in the range of nanoscale. After the characterization of our gold textured surfaces by atomic force and scanning electron microscopies, we demonstrate the link between wettability surface properties and gold nanoparticles size. The experimental results indicate the influence of the laser intensity, the irradiation time and the polymer film thickness (by increasing the gold concentration) on the gold nanoparticle density and size.

Abstract
In this work we propose the evolution of a new class of optical pressure sensors suitable for robot tactile sensing. The sensors are based on a tapered optical fiber, where optical signals travel embedded into a PDMS-gold nanocomposite material. By applying different pressure forces on the PDMS-based nanocomposite we measure in real time the change of the optical transmitted intensity due to the coupling between the gold nanocomposite material and the tapered fiber region. The intensity reduction of the transmitted light intensity is correlated with the pressure force magnitude.

Abstract
A method of in situ formation of patterns of size controlled CdS nanocrystals in a polymer matrix by pulsed UV irradiation is presented. The films consist of Cd thiolate precursors with different carbon chain lengths embedded in TOPAS polymer matrices. Under UV irradiation the precursors are photolyzed, driving to the formation of CdS nanocrystals in the quantum size regime, with size and concentration defined by the number of incident UV pulses, while the host polymer remains macroscopically/microscopically unaffected. The emission of the formed nanocomposite materials strongly depends on the dimensions of the CdS nanocrystals, thus, their growth at the different phases of the irradiation is monitored using spatially resolved photoluminescence by means of a confocal microscope. X-ray diffraction measurements verified the existence of the CdS nanocrystals, and defined their crystal structure for all the studied cases. The results are reinforced by transmission electron microscopy. It is proved that the selection of the precursor determines the efficiency of the procedure, and the quality of the formed nanocrystals. Moreover it is demonstrated that there is the possibility of laser induced formation of well-defined patterns of CdS nanocrystals, opening up new perspectives in the development of nanodevices.

Abstract
We report on the wettability properties of silicon surfaces, simultaneously structured on the micrometre-scale and the nanometre-scale by femtosecond (fs) laser irradiation to render silicon hydrophobic. By varying the laser fluence, it was possible to control the wetting properties of a silicon surface through a systematic and reproducible variation of the surface roughness. In particular, the silicon-water contact angle could be increased from 66° to more than 130°. Such behaviour is described by incomplete liquid penetration within the silicon features, still leaving partially trapped air inside. We also show how controllable design and tailoring of the surface microstructures by wettability gradients can drive the motion of the drop's centre of mass towards a desired direction (even upwards).

Abstract
The aim of this study was to evaluate the efficacy and tolerability of carboplatin, docetaxel plus irinotecan given weekly to patients with locally advanced or metastatic non-small cell lung cancer (NSCLC). 50 patients with previously untreated NSCLC (stage IIIB 10; stage IV 40; 44% squamous cell carcinoma; median Eastern Cooperative Oncology Group (ECOG) status 1) received intravenous (i.v.) carboplatin area under the curve (AUC) 2, docetaxel 20 mg/m(2) and irinotecan 60 mg/m(2) on days 1, 8 and 15, repeated every 5 weeks. Prophylactic granulocyte colony-stimulating factor (G-CSF) 150 ug/m(2) was given from days 3 to 6 and 10 to 13. Response was evaluated every two cycles. Four complete responses (8%) and 24 (48%) partial responses were observed, giving an overall intent-to-treat response rate of 56%. 8 patients (16%) achieved stable disease and 14 (28%) progressed. The median time to progression (TTP) was 9.6 months (range 2.5-21.8 months), median survival was 14.8 months (range 0.3-27+ months) and actuarial 1-year survival time was 55%. Grade 3/4 anaemia and thrombocytopenia occurred in 18 and 22% of patients, respectively; 13 patients (26%) developed grade 3/4 neutropenia and 7 (14%) had neutropenic fever that required hospitalisation, but was successfully treated with antibiotics and G-CSF support. One patient developed a severe allergy during docetaxel administration and was withdrawn. Other grade 3/4 adverse events included diarrhoea (n=14; 3 required hospitalisation), nausea/vomiting (n=9), neurotoxicity (n=5) and fatigue (n=5). 6 patients required a dose reduction. This combination of i.v. carboplatin AUC 2, docetaxel 20 mg/m(2) and irinotecan 60 mg/m(2) given weekly is highly effective in the treatment of chemotherapy-naïve advanced NSCLC. Toxicity was moderate, but manageable.

Abstract
PURPOSE To evaluate the efficacy and toxicity of a combination of weekly docetaxel, gemcitabine and cisplatin in advanced transitional cell carcinoma (TCC) of the bladder. PATIENTS AND METHODS Thirty-five chemotherapy-naïve (adjuvant and neoadjuvant chemotherapy was allowed) patients with advanced TCC received intravenous docetaxel 35 mg/m2, gemcitabine 800 mg/m2 and cisplatin 35 mg/m2, on days 1 and 8 every 3 weeks. Prophylactic granulocyte-colony stimulating factor was given from days 3 to 6 and days 10 to 15, anti-emetics were used routinely. RESULTS Most (27) patients (77.1%) had a performance status of 0 to 1 and eight (22.9%) had received prior adjuvant or neoadjuvant cisplatin-based chemotherapy. In the intention-to-treat analysis, the objective response rate was 65.6% [23/35 patients, 95% confidence interval (CI) 47.8% to 80.9%]. Ten patients (28.5%) achieved a complete response (95% CI 14.6% to 46.3%) and 13 (37.1%) a partial response (95% CI 21.5% to 55.0%). Median survival time was 15.5 months, median duration of response was 10.2 months and median time to progression was 8.9 months. Ten patients (28.5%) developed grade 3/4 neutropenia, including five (14.3%) who experienced febrile neutropenia, which was successfully treated. Grade 3/4 anaemia and thrombocytopenia occurred in 20% and 25.7% of patients, respectively; four patients required platelet transfusions. There were no treatment-related deaths. CONCLUSIONS Weekly docetaxel, gemcitabine plus cisplatin is a highly effective treatment for chemotherapy-naïve advanced TCC, and causes only moderate toxicity. This regimen should be considered as a suitable option that deserves further prospective evaluation through randomised phase III trials.

Abstract
The objective of this study is to determine the maternal and neonatal outcome of a large group of triplet gestations. A retrospective review of 100 triplet gestations managed and delivered between January 1992 and September 1999 by a single perinatal group is examined. These pregnancies were managed on an outpatient basis. Prophylactic interventions were not utilized. Ninety-six percent of the pregnancies had at least one complication, with preterm labor the most common. The median gestational age at delivery was 33 weeks (range 20.4 to 37, SD 4.1 weeks) with 14% of pregnancies delivering prior to 28 weeks' gestation. The corrected perinatal mortality rate was 97/1000. Minimal long-term morbidity was seen with delivery after 27 weeks' gestation. Pregnancy outcome did not vary with birth order or mode of conception. Triplet pregnancy is associated with a high rate ofantenatal complications. Favorable neonatal outcome can be obtained without the use of prophylactic interventions.

Abstract
Cisplatin (CDDP), epirubicin (EPI) and docetaxel have single agent activity against urothelial transitional cell carcinoma (TCC). We evaluated the efficacy and toxicity of this combination in locally advanced or metastatic urothelial TCC. Patients with urothelial TCC who had no prior chemotherapy (prior adjuvant chemotherapy > 6 months allowed) were eligible for entry the study. Eligibility criteria were performance status 0-3, granulocyte count (AGC) > or = 1.5 (10(9)/l), platelet count > or = 100 (10(9)/l), clearance creatine > or = 60 ml/min and total bilirubin level < or = 1.5 mg/dl. Treatment consisted of EPI 40 mg/m2 intravenous push, docetaxel 75 mg/m2 in 1 h infusion with premedication and CDDP 75 mg/m2 with pre- and posthydration. Treatment was repeated every 21 days. Antiemetics with dexamethasone and 5-HT3 antagonists were used routinely. Prophylactic haematopoietic growth factors were not used. Patients were evaluated for toxicity weekly and assessed for response every two cycles of treatment. 32 patients were entered into the study and 30 patients (7 with locally advanced and 23 with metastatic disease) were assessable for response. There were 9 (30.0%) complete responses (2, 28.6% in locally advanced and 7, 30.4% in metastatic disease) and 11 (36.7%) partial responses (3, 42.9% in locally advanced and 8, 34.8% in metastatic disease) with an overall response rate (RR) of 66.7% (71.5% in locally advanced, 65.2% in metastatic disease). Overall median survival was 14.5 months (15 months for locally advanced, 12.5 months for metastatic disease). The median duration of response in patients with metastatic disease was 8.5 months. 16 (53.3%) patients required one dose reduction and 5 (16.7%) patients required two dose reductions for a nadir AGC < or = 500/mm3. Four episodes of febrile neutropenia and sepsis occurred. No patient had a dose reduction or treatment delay for any other grade 3/4 toxicity. There were no treatment delays due to myelotoxicity. Alopecia was universal. Non-haematological toxicity including mucositis, fluid retention, allergy, cutaneous toxicity, diarrhoea and neurotoxicity were mild and infrequent. The combination of EPI, docetaxel and CDDP is an active regimen for urothelial TCC. The response rate and toxicity were comparable with the M-VAC (methotrexate, vinblastine, doxorubicin, cisplastin) regimen. Phase III trials comparing this regimen with M-VAC are warranted.

Abstract
PURPOSE To evaluate the efficacy and toxicity of the combination of carboplatin, docetaxel, and gemcitabine in patients with advanced non-small-cell lung cancer (NSCLC). PATIENTS AND METHODS Forty-five chemotherapy-naive patients with NSCLC were treated on an out-patient basis with carboplatin area under the curve 5 intravenous (IV) and gemcitabine 800 mg/m(2) IV on day 1 and docetaxel 75 mg/m(2) IV and gemcitabine 800 mg/m(2) IV on day 8. Granulocyte colony-stimulating factor (150 ug/m(2) subcutaneously) was given prophylactically from day 3 to day 6 and day 10 to day 16. Chemotherapy was repeated every 4 weeks. Patients were evaluated for response every two cycles of treatment. RESULTS The median age of the patients was 58 years (range, 24 to 75 years). The performance status was 0 for 16 patients, 1 for 17 patients, and 2 for 12 patients. Nine patients (20%) had stage IIIB disease, and 36 (80%) had stage IV; histology was mainly squamous cell carcinoma (51.2% of patients) that was poorly differentiated (37.8%). All 45 patients were assessable for toxicity, and 41 were assessable for response. On an intent-to-treat analysis, the objective response rate was 46. 5% (21 out of 45 patients; 95% confidence interval [CI], 31.7% to 62. 5%). Of the 45 patients, four (8.8%) achieved a complete response (95% CI, 2.5% to 21.2%); 17 (37.7%) achieved a partial response (95% CI, 23.8% to 53.5%); seven (15.5%) had stable disease; and 14 (31. 1%) had progressive disease. The median survival time was 13.5 months, and the actuarial 1-year survival rate was 51.11%. The median duration of response was 7.6 months, and the time to tumor progression was 8.1 months. Grade 3/4 anemia and thrombocytopenia occurred in 17.7% and 28.8% of patients, respectively. Twenty-one patients (46.6%) developed grade 3/4 neutropenia, and six patients (13.3%) were complicated with fever. Alopecia was universal. Grade 3 diarrhea occurred in four patients (8.8%); grade 3/4 neurotoxicity occurred in 10 patients (22.2%); and grade 2/3 allergic reaction occurred in three patients (16.6%). There were no treatment-related deaths. Six patients (13.3%) required a dose reduction, two of which required two reductions. CONCLUSIONS The combination of carboplatin, docetaxel, and gemcitabine is an effective regimen for the treatment of chemotherapy-naive patients with advanced NSCLC, causing only moderate toxicity.

Abstract
OBJECTIVE To establish the charges associated with triplet pregnancies managed at a single tertiary center, over a 5-year time period, and to evaluate the impact of prematurity on these charges. METHODS All triplet pregnancies that reached at least 20 weeks gestation and received prenatal and neonatal care at our center from 1992 to 1996 were included. Charges for these mothers and neonates were extracted from two separate hospital billing computer systems, encompassing all inpatient, outpatient, technical, and professional charges. Linear regression was used to evaluate the relationship between gestational age at delivery and total charges. RESULTS Fifty-five triplet pregnancies were included, resulting in the admission of 149 liveborn neonates. The median gestational age at delivery was 32.1 weeks. The mean charges per triplet mother were: $6,899 (professional), $3,959 (hospital outpatient), and $32,686 (hospital inpatient). The mean charges per neonatal sibling set were: $20,107 (professional) and $124,163 (hospital inpatient). The mean charges per complete triplet pregnancy was $187,814 (maternal plus neonatal). There was a significant inverse relationship between gestational age at delivery and total charges per triplet family, with a decrease of $16,584 for each additional gestational week reached (P = 0.006). CONCLUSIONS Triplet pregnancy charges averaged almost $190,000 each, which does not include charges associated with assisted reproductive technologies. These charges are almost all related to the expense of prolonged neonatal intensive care, and are significantly related to the gestational age at delivery. Efforts at containing these costs should focus on reducing the incidence of multiple gestation and preventing prematurity.

Abstract
OBJECTIVE To evaluate the dependability of a live telemedicine link for the transmission of obstetric ultrasonograms using a commercial telephone network. MATERIALS AND METHODS We established an integrated services digital network (ISDN), consisting of three dedicated telephone lines from three satellite offices, to our central prenatal diagnostic center. All patients had a sonographic evaluation recorded on videotape by a trained sonographer. A live interactive video telemedicine link was then established, and a perinatologist directed the sonographer through the scan. A report was issued on the basis of the telemedicine examination. The number of calls required to obtain satisfactory real-time images was recorded, as were the reasons for suboptimal transmissions. The first 150 transmissions were excluded from this study. The results in the subsequent 100 patients who agreed to participate were analyzed. RESULTS We were able to provide obstetric interpretations in all 100 patients scheduled to be examined using the telemedicine link. A single connection was required in 85 cases, two calls in 5 cases, three calls in 8 cases, four calls in 1 case, and five calls in another case. A repeat call was required in 20 cases because of poor image transmission; other repeat calls were caused by failure to connect (5 cases), calls disconnected (2 cases), and no image transmission (2 cases). CONCLUSIONS The provision of telemedicine services for obstetric ultrasonography in the community is feasible, but the need for repeat connections because of technical failures needs to be incorporated into cost and time analyses in order to provide a measure of the system's efficiency.

Abstract
OBJECTIVE To evaluate objectively the effect of different bandwidths on the ability to interpret obstetric ultrasound scans transmitted live over a commercial telephone network. MATERIALS AND METHODS An integrated services digital network (ISDN) was established from three satellite offices to our central prenatal diagnostic center. In the first half of the study, the network was based on four ISDN channels transmitting at a bandwidth of 256 kbits per second (kbps), while in the second half of the study, this was increased to six ISDN channels transmitting at 384 kbps. A physician trained in obstetric ultrasonography provided an interpretation of fetal anatomy using a live, real-time telemedicine link. A scoring system consisting of 33 anatomic items was used to evaluate image quality objectively. The number of transmissions complicated by motion artifact was also recorded. RESULTS One hundred patients had a fetal anatomy survey performed using the 256 kbps system, and these interpretations were compared with those from another group of 100 patients who were examined using the 384 kbps system. Although the visibility of the 33 anatomic items was similar using the two systems, significantly more examinations at 256 kbps were complicated by motion artifact (12% vs. 3%; P = 0.02). CONCLUSIONS Remote sonographic viewing of fetal anatomy was adequate using both 256 and 384 kbps systems, although motion artifact was significantly more likely to occur using the slower system. This problem may affect the ability of the lower-bandwidth system to allow optimal detection when fetal anomalies are present.

Abstract
OBJECTIVE The purpose of this study was to describe the cost implications of converting an established videotape review network for obstetric ultrasonography to one based on telemedicine technology. DESIGN Retrospective review of fixed and non-fixed costs associated with interpreting obstetric ultrasound examinations using both videotape and telemedicine transmission. SUBJECTS A network of three community offices transmitting 600 obstetric ultrasound examinations per month to a central tertiary level facility. METHODS Sonographers at the community offices record ultrasound examinations onto videotape, which are then sent by courier to a central facility for interpretation. At the completion of this videotaped examination, sonographers repeat the ultrasound scan while transmitting real-time images over a telemedicine link to the central facility. Costs associated with the videotape review technique that can be avoided by converting to telemedicine interpretation were derived and compared with the fixed and non-fixed costs associated with establishing the telemedicine network. RESULTS For this network, the fixed costs for establishing telemedicine are $101,750. Monthly non-fixed cost savings by eliminating videotape review include $1620 to $2700 for printing still images, $1200 for courier charges and $7000 for fewer repeat ultrasound examinations. Monthly non-fixed costs for the telemedicine network are $2415. Net monthly savings in non-fixed costs for a telemedicine network are therefore $7405 to $8585, which may pay for the initial fixed costs in 12 to 14 months. CONCLUSIONS The high cost of a telemedicine network may be offset by possible savings in non-fixed costs compared with alternative systems for interpreting obstetric ultrasonography.

Abstract
There are no published guidelines on how to assess fetal well-being during hemodialysis. We have developed a specific protocol of renal and obstetric interventions to ensure that hemodialysis is associated with minimal changes in fetal status. We tested this protocol serially over a 9-week period in a pregnant patient who was undergoing chronic hemodialysis for end-stage renal disease. Testing involved serial assessments of uterine and umbilical artery blood flow with Doppler velocimetry and continuous fetal heart rate tracings, before, during and after each hemodialysis session. We found that, by strict adherence to these guidelines, there were no significant alterations in maternal mean arterial blood pressure, continuous fetal heart rate tracings, uterine artery systolic/diastolic ratios, or umbilical artery systolic/diastolic ratios. We conclude that stable uteroplacental and fetal perfusion can be maintained during chronic hemodialysis in pregnancy by adhering to a specific set of precautions.

Abstract
A phase II trial was conducted in order to assess the efficacy and toxicity of paclitaxel given at a dose of 175 mg/m2 in a 3-hour infusion every 3 weeks in patients with recurrent or cisplatin (CDDP) carboplatin-refractory ovarian cancer. Forty-two patients with a median age of 61 years (range 34-76 years) entered the study. Most patients had bulky disease. Thirty-three patients (78.5 %) presented with stage III and IV diseases. Twenty-two patients (52.3%) had previously been treated with only 1 regimen and 20 patients (47.7%) with > or = 2 regimens. The median treatment interval from the last previous therapy was 4.5 months (range 2-26 months). From 41 patients evaluable for response, 3 (7.3%) achieved a complete and 4 (9.8%) a partial response. All 3 complete and 2 out of the 4 partial responders had previously received > or = 2 chemotherapeutic regimens. Grade 3-4 toxicities included granulocytopenia (35%), which was of short duration, neurotoxicity (9.75%) and alopecia (60.9%). Two patients with grade 4 neutropenia were hospitalized due to pneumonia, which was successfully treated by broad-spectrum antibiotics and administration of G-CSF. A severe hypersensitivity reaction occurred in 1 patient early during the first cycle, resulting in discontinuation of treatment. Median relapse-free survival was 6.9 months, median time to progression 6.2 months and median survival 13.2 months. In conclusion, paclitaxel given at a dose of 175 mg/m2 as a 3-hour infusion every 3 weeks appears to be an efficacious and well-tolerated treatment in patients with recurrent or CDDP/carboplatin-refractory ovarian cancer.

Abstract
Forty-four patients with either metastatic or locally advanced transitional cell carcinoma of the bladder were treated with the MCNO regimen (methotrexate 300 mg/m2 in 1,000 ml normal saline as a 4-hour infusion on days 1 and 14 with leucovorin rescue 15 mg 6-hourly for 6 doses; carboplatin 300 mg/m2 in 250 ml 5% distilled water as a 1-hour infusion on day 1; mitoxantrone (Novantrone) 10 mg/m2 in 100 ml 5% distilled water as a 30-min infusion on day 1, and vincristine (Oncovin) 1 mg/m2 as an intravenous bolus on days 1 and 14. Patients with metastatic disease were treated with 6 cycles, while patients with locally advanced disease were treated with 4 cycles of induction chemotherapy followed by cystectomy or radiotherapy. The overall response rate was 40%, with 15% complete response (CR). The responses were better for patients with locally advanced disease (CR 25%, partial response, PR, 31.25%, response rate, RR, 56.25%) than for those with metastatic disease (CR 8.3%, PR 20.83%, RR 29.1 %). The differences in these results were probably due to the bad performance status and the presence of visceral metastases in patients with generalized disease. The overall median survival was 14 months, with responders living longer (median survival 28.8 months in patients with locally advanced disease and 22.9 months in patients with metastatic disease) than non-responders (median survival 16 months in patients with locally advanced disease and 8.9 months in patients with metastatic disease). The difference in survival between responders and non-responders was statistically significant in both groups of patients. Toxicity was moderate, but manageable. The MCNO regimen appears to have a lower efficacy than that obtained with cisplatin-based regimens for the treatment of metastatic disease and rather similar efficacy for the treatment of locally advanced urothelial-cell cancer. Therapy with this regimen, though less toxic, may not be a reliable alternative in elderly patients with visceral metastases and a performance status of > or = 2.

Abstract
A prospective phase II trial was carried out to define the activity of a low-dose subcutaneous regimen of interleukin-2 (IL-2) and interferon alpha-2b (IFN-alpha) in combination with intravenous administration of vinblastine (VLB) in patients with metastatic renal cell cancer (RCC). Thirty-one patients with advanced RCC who had received no prior biochemotherapy were treated with IL-2 4.5 MU x 2/24 h thrice weekly for 2 weeks, IFN-alpha 3 MU/24 h thrice weekly (alternating days) for 2 consecutive weeks and VLB 4 mg/m2 every 3 weeks. Patients were to have a 1-week rest period after each 2 weeks of therapy with cytokines. Treatment was repeated every 3 weeks. Maximum duration of treatment was 1 year. Treatment was administered on an outpatient basis. There were 4 complete (12.9%) and 8 partial responses (25.8%), with an overall response rate of 38.7%. The median duration of response was 6.5 months. Responses were seen in lung, lymph nodes, bones, liver and other tumor metastases. Toxicity was mild to moderate, consisting of fever, anorexia, malaise and nausea-vomiting in > 80% of patients. Hypotension and transient alopecia occurred in > 20% of patients. Liver enzyme elevation was frequently observed. Treatment-induced eosinophilia occurred in the majority of patients, while in 52% of patients granulocytopenia grade II and grade III did not require dose modification of drugs. Transient inflammation and local induration at the injection sites was observed in the majority of patients. None of the patients experienced major VLB-related toxicity and no toxic deaths occurred. This three-drug combination immunochemotherapy may be a promising regimen with modest toxicity in advanced RCC.

Abstract
The objective of this article is to describe maternal morbidity in a large cohort of triplet pregnancies managed by a single Maternal-Fetal Medicine group over a short period of time. Records from all triplet pregnancies managed and delivered from 1992 to 1996 were reviewed for maternal outcome data. Pregnancies delivered prior to 20 weeks were excluded. During the 4-year study period, 55 triplet pregnancies were managed and delivered at this center. The most common maternal complication was preterm labor, which occurred in 42 cases (76%). Preterm premature rupture of membranes occurred in 11 cases (20%). Pregnancy-induced hypertensive complications occurred in 15 cases (27%), which included severe preeclampsia 13 (24%), hemolysis, elevated liver function tests, and low platelets (HELLP) syndrome 5 (9%), and eclampsia 1 (2%). Other maternal antenatal complications included anemia 15 (27%), acute fatty liver of pregnancy 4 (7%), gestational diabetes 4 (7%), supraventricular tachyarrhythmias 2 (4%), dermatoses 2 (4%), urinary tract infection 2 (4%), and acute disc prolapse requiring surgery in 1 case (2%). Postnatal complications occurred in 18 cases (33%), including endometritis 13 (24%), postpartum hemorrhage 5 (9%), pneumonia 2 (4%), urinary tract infection 2 (4%), and diastasis of rectus muscles requiring surgery in 1 (2%). There were no maternal deaths. Antenatal and postnatal maternal complications occur in almost all triplet gestations, suggesting that such pregnancies be managed at centers that have appropriate multidisciplinary expertise available.

Abstract
Forty patients with previously untreated epithelial ovarian cancer (OC), with FIGO stages Ic-IV, were randomly allocated to receive intravenously either carboplatin (C) 400 mg/m2 every three weeks (C arm, 20 patients) or a combination of C 350 mg/m2, ifosfamide (I) 5 g/m2 with mesna every three weeks, vincristine (V) 1.4 mg/m2 (maximum total dose 2 mg) and bleomycin (B) 30 mg every ten days (CIVB arm, 20 patients). Responding patients received 6 courses of chemotherapy and all 40 patients were evaluable for toxicity, response and survival. Clinical characteristics of patients were similar in both arms. Clinico-imaging results with chemotherapy were as follows: in C arm, clinical complete remission (cCR) 11 (55%) and partial remission (cPR) five (25%) patients for an overall response rate (ORR) 80%. For CIVB arm, cCR ten (50%) and cPR four (20%) patients for an ORR 70%. Second look operation (SLO) was performed in three of the 11 cCR patients in the C arm and six of the ten cCR patients in the CIVB arm. Pathological CR (pCR) was confirmed in two of the three cCR C arm patients and two of the six in the CIVB patients. In the first interim analysis statistically significant differences, all favoring monochemotherapy, were seen in response duration, time to progression, disease-free and overall survival. These results along with the severe myelotoxicity resulting in dose reductions in the CIVB patients led us to stop enrolling new patients and follow this population closely for long-term results. These confirmed the first observations of the superiority of single-agent carboplatin in response duration (p = 0.034), time to progression (p = 0.028), disease-free survival (p = 0.010) and overall survival (p = 0.043). Because of the above reasons we have concluded that monochemotherapy with carboplatin is to be preferred over carboplatin in combination with other drugs.

Abstract
BACKGROUND Reports suggest that perinatal infection with Brucella abortus does not cause poor obstetric outcomes, because of protective mechanisms in the human, not seen in animal species. CASE We report a case of maternal brucellosis resulting in preterm labor, chorioamnionitis, placental abruption, and delivery of a live-born infant at 25 weeks' gestational age. Both maternal blood cultures and amniotic fluid cultures were positive for B abortus species, and delivery occurred despite aggressive antibiotic and tocolytic therapy. CONCLUSION Maternal infection with B abortus during pregnancy can lead to significant perinatal morbidity, casting doubt on reports that human pregnancy is resistant to such infection.

Abstract
OBJECTIVE To determine whether there is a gender discrepancy in severe twin-twin transfusion syndrome. METHODS All cases of twin-twin transfusion syndrome evaluated between 1989 and 1996 were reviewed retrospectively. The following sonographic criteria were used: a single placenta, a thin membrane, the same gender, a combination of polyhydramnios-oligohydramnios, a stuck twin, and an estimated weight discordance exceeding 20%. At least five of six sonographic criteria were required for inclusion in the study. Only severe cases, which were defined as early onset (before 30 weeks' gestation), a combination of polyhydramnios and oligohydramnios, a stuck twin, fetal hydrops, fetal death, or the requirement of medical or invasive treatment, were included. Chorionicity was confirmed by placental examination when available. RESULTS Thirty-seven twin pregnancies met the above criteria, of which 33 (89%) twin pairs were female. The median gestational age at presentation was 19 weeks (range, 15-29; standard deviation, 5.6). A single placenta, thin membrane, same gender, and polyhydramnios-oligohydramnios were present in every case. A stuck twin was noted in 34 of 37 cases (92%), and a growth discordance exceeding 20% was present in 26 of 36 (72%). Placental pathology, which was available in 31 (84%) cases, confirmed a monochorionic placentation in 29. Twenty-five (68%) cases had reduction amniocentesis, two were treated with indomethacin, one underwent a cord ligation, and in four cases, fetal death occurred before treatment was instituted. CONCLUSION There is a significant female preponderance in pregnancies complicated by severe twin-twin transfusion syndrome. The reasons for this are nuclear, but they may be related to either placental or fetal gender-specific differences affecting a subset of monochorionic twin pregnancies.

Abstract
OBJECTIVE To establish whether first-trimester obstetric ultrasonography interpreted by a live video telemedicine link is comparable to an established videotape review network in a low-risk patient population. METHODS An integrated services digital network was established from three satellite offices to our central prenatal diagnostic center. All patients had a sonographic evaluation of the uterus, adnexa, and gestational sac recorded onto videotape by a trained sonographer. A live, interactive video telemedicine link was established, and a perinatologist directed the sonographer through the scan. Subsequently, a different perinatologist, blinded to the telemedicine interpretation, reviewed the original videotaped examination. The reports generated from both modalities then were compared by means of a score of 12 sonographic characteristics. RESULTS The first 100 patients were included. The mean gestational age (+/-standard deviation) was 8.9 +/- 2.3 weeks (range 5.7-14.4), and the mean duration for telemedicine scans was 7.8 +/- 2.9 minutes (range 3.8-20.1). Telemedicine and videotape review scores were the same in 95 cases, and the final diagnosis was identical in 98 cases. This study had 80% power to detect a 10% difference in diagnosis at a significance level of .05. The ability to detect abnormalities was equivalent using both systems. CONCLUSION The interpretation of first-trimester obstetric ultrasonography using live video telemedicine is equivalent to a system of videotape review. Obstetric telemedicine may prove to be a useful tool for providing sonographic imaging for low-risk obstetric patients.

Abstract
OBJECTIVE Our purpose was to establish whether obstetric ultrasonography interpreted by a live video telemedicine link is comparable to interpretation by videotape review in a low-risk patient population. STUDY DESIGN An Integrated Services Digital Network (ISDN 6) was established from three satellite offices to our central prenatal diagnostic center. Patients seen at these satellite offices had a complete fetal anatomic survey recorded onto videotape by a trained ultrasonographer. A live interactive video telemedicine link was then established to our center by the digital network, and a perinatologist directed the ultrasonographer through the anatomy survey. Subsequently a different perinatologist, blinded to the telemedicine interpretation, reviewed the videotaped examination. The reports from the videotaped and telemedicine scans were then compared on the basis of a score of 33 anatomic items. RESULTS The first 200 patients seen at the satellite offices were included. Telemedicine and videotape interpretations provided similar scores in 84% of scans. In 17 of the 33 anatomic categories telemedicine provided significantly better scores than videotape, whereas in the remaining 16 anatomic categories the scores were equivalent. More videotape than telemedicine examinations required repeat ultrasonography because of suboptimal imaging (10% vs 3%, p = 0.003). CONCLUSIONS The interpretation of obstetric ultrasonography with use of live video telemedicine is comparable to videotape review. Fetal telemedicine may prove to be a useful tool for providing ultrasonographic interpretation of fetal anatomy to a network of low-risk obstetric practices.

Abstract
The 'double bubble' sign in prenatal diagnosis is most often associated with duodenal atresia. However, other causes of upper intestinal obstruction and cystic abdominal masses need to be considered. One possible diagnosis that can mimic the 'double bubble' sign of duodenal atresia is duodenal duplication, but little information is available to guide sonologists in the prenatal diagnosis of this rare congenital anomaly. In this case report we describe the successful prenatal diagnosis of duodenal duplication, by relying on the early gestational age of presentation, the lack of polyhydramnios, the failure to consistently demonstrate a 'double bubble' on transverse images, and the presence of a normal distal bowel pattern.

Abstract
This study was conducted to investigate the clinical utility of CEA, CA 19-9, and CA-50 in the diagnosis, monitoring, and prognosis of 62 gastric carcinoma patients having either adjuvant or palliative chemotherapy. Patients were divided in two groups: group A included patients treated on an adjuvant basis following a curative resection of gastric cancer, and group B included patients with residual disease post surgery or patients with inoperable tumor or generalized disease. Serum marker levels were measured in a prospective study just before the initiation of chemotherapy and before each course during chemotherapy. In group A, CEA was positive in 2/25 (8%) patients, CA 19-9 in 1/25 (4%), and CA-50 in 1/25 (4%). In group B the sensitivity of CEA was 48.6% (18/37 patients), of CA 19-9 64.9% (27/37 patients), and of CA-50 70.3% (26/37) patients. There was a significant correlation between the CA 19-9 and CA-50 levels in both groups. No correlation was found between the sensitivity or the absolute initial marker levels and the tumor's differentiation or extent of disease. In group A the only patient with initially elevated CA 19-9 and CA-50 values relapsed early while he was on adjuvant chemotherapy. It was also found that the rising final CA 19-9 and CA-50 values at the end of chemotherapy were correlated with an increased incidence of relapse, but not with the disease-free interval. In group B the initially low marker levels showed a trend to predict a favorable outcome of treatment. There was no statistically significant correlation between the marker titers before each course and response to chemotherapy. It is concluded that the comeasurement of CA 19-9 and CA-50, and to some degree of CEA, is justifiable for gastric cancer. The estimation of CA 19-9 and CA-50 may be useful for early detection of recurrence after curative surgery and adjuvant chemotherapy. In advanced or recurrent gastric cancer, the estimation of either CA 19-9 or CA-50 and CEA serum values may help in checking the prognosis, determining the efficacy of palliative treatment modalities, and recognizing recurrences.

Abstract
This study was conducted to evaluate the efficacy of two different doses of ondansetron (8 mg vs. 24 mg) plus dexamethasone in the prevention of cisplatin (CDDP)-induced emesis and nausea (acute and delayed). The persistence of the anti-emetic efficacy during the second cycle of chemotherapy was also assessed. Eighty patients receiving high-dose CDDP (>80 mg/m2) were randomized to have either ondansetron 8 mg plus dexamethasone 20 mg (8 mg group) or ondansetron 24 mg plus dexamethasone 20 mg (24 mg group), given intravenously as a single dose before the CDDP infusion. From days 2-5, all patients received oral ondansetron 8 mg twice daily. Seventy-five patients (38 in the 8 mg group and 37 in the 24 mg group) were evaluable for analysis. Among these, there were 24 patients who received ifosfamide (IFO) on the 2nd day of treatment; these patients were evaluated separately for delayed emesis. Complete protection from acute emesis was obtained in 26 (68.4%) and 26 (70.3%) patients, in the two groups, respectively. Complete protection against acute nausea was achieved in 23 (60.5%) and 24 (64.9%) patients, respectively. With respect to the delayed emesis, complete protection was achieved in 14 (56%) and 13 (50%) patients not receiving IFO and in 4 (30.8%) and 3 (27.3%) of those receiving IFO. The figures for the delayed nausea were: 12 (48%) and 13 (50%), 2 (15.4%) and 2 (18.2%), respectively. Similar protection against emesis and nausea was recorded during the second cycle of chemotherapy. Both regimens have the same efficacy and thus, taking into account the cost-effectiveness, 8 mg of ondansetron plus dexamethasone in a single intravenous dose should be used for the prevention of high-dose CDDP-induced emesis.
